The former Director General of Police (DGP) R. Sreelekha has submitted a plea before the Kerala High Court seeking to quash a case registered against her earlier this month under the Protection of Children from Sexual Offences (POCSO) Act for allegedly revealing the identity of minor rape survivors through her YouTube channel. Ms. Sreelekha is a councillor of the Thiruvananthapuram Corporation now.

The case had been filed under provisions of the POCSO Act and Section 72 (that prohibits the printing or publishing of any matter that reveals the identity of a victim of sexual offences)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ita. According to the First Information Report (FIR), the episode in question related to the Kiliroor and Kaviyoor sexual assault cases and allegedly disclosed details that could lead to the identification of the survivors. The FIR also says that the names of their parents were also revealed.
